High temperature plastics
TEPLAST also has perfect thermoplastic solutions for use in extreme areas. If the plastic parts are exposed to extreme temperatures above 150 °C, if they come into contact with alkalis, acids and other chemicals, or if other extreme properties are required, we use particularly high-quality materials such as PEEK, PSU, ECTFE, PVDF, PEI, PPSU, PES, etc. for the production of the corresponding milled and turned parts. It is precisely these materials that bring the superior properties of polymers – such as sliding friction behavior, weight savings and chemical resistance – to bear even at high continuous service temperatures.
